Hugo Cabret in Good Hands

-- School Library Journal, 6/1/2008

Author Brian Selznick is confident director Chris Wedge will do an amazing job bringing The Invention of Hugo Cabret (Scholastic, 2007) to the big screen.

Selznick says he's looking forward to seeing how the Ice Age and Robots director will incorporate his command of technology into the live-action film. The Caldecott-winning author, who had many producers vying for the movie rights, went with Grey Rembert, vice president of development at the Graham King company. John Logan, who wrote the screenplay for The Aviator and Sweeney Todd, has also signed on. Johnny Depp's production company Infinitum Nihil is coproducing the Warner Bros. film with Graham King's Initial Entertainment Group.
